Usuario
VS2008 Imprimir CrystalReports diferentes bandejas

Pregunta
-
Hola buenas tardes, a ver si alguien me puede ayudar con ésto:
Tengo una aplicación desarrollada en VB de VS2008, que tiene varios informes de Crystal Reports. Cada uno de éstos informes tengo que imprimirlos en la misma impresora, pero en diferentes bandejas de la misma.
He visto que se puede configurar la bandeja utilizando el PrintOptions.PaperSource, pero las opciones que da son las "básicas" ésto es: Auto, Cassete, Envelope, Upper, Middle, Lower, Manual...etc. Mi problema es que ninguna de ellas me sirve para identificar la Bandeja 4 de mi impresora (una Kyocera FS-9130), y obligatoriamente tengo que imprimir por dicha bandeja.
Si he conseguido imprimir por la Bandeja 4 accediendo al PrinterSettings.PaperSources.Item(4) de una instancia de objeto PrintDocument, pero por éste otro método lo que no consigo es imprimir el informe de Crystal Reports.
Muchas gracias, un saludo,
Jonathan
- Cambiado Eduardo PorteschellerModerator lunes, 18 de abril de 2011 17:07 (De:Lenguaje VB.NET)
Todas las respuestas
-
hola
pero quieres conseguir esta funcionaldiad desde codigo, o desde la opcion manual desplegada al usuario ?
imagino que si el usuario tiene correctamente instalado el driver d ela imprsota al seleccionarla deberia mostrar esta funcionalidad
si tienes un docuemnto de Word y usas las opciones de impresion, tiene esta opcion de seleccionr la bandeja ?
si en Word ya no la tienes es ams que seguro en Crystal tampoco las veras
recuerda que este usa los cuadro de impresion estandar proporcionados por el sistema operativo
saludos
Leandro Tuttini
Blog
Buenos Aires
Argentina -
Hola, gracias por la respuesta,
Necesito imprimir los informes desde código, sin que al usuario le muestre ninguna bandeja ni tenga que interactuar, debe ser todo automático. En el proceso se lanzan a la vez varios informes, uno detrás de otro, pero cada uno debe imprimirse con papeles de diferentes colores, por esa razón es necesario que cada uno extraiga de una bandeja diferente de la misma impresora.
Muchas gracias,
Jonathan Prieto
-